Dramatic Discourse in Tom Murphy's "The Patriot Game" and Felix Mitterer's "In der Loewengrube"

The aim of this study was to expose the constructed nature of national identity in two dramatic texts: The Patriot Game (1991) by Irish playwright Tom Murphy and In der Loewengrube (1989) by his Austrian counterpart Felix Mitterer. Utilizing a multidisciplinary approach combining linguistics, literature, history and cultural studies, this thesis looked at similarities and dissimilarities in the construction and deconstruction of national identity in the two plays. Ruth Wodak et al.'s linguistic approach developed in the work on Critical Discourse Analysis describing the construction of national identity in non-literary texts provided a framework, which has been modified for the analysis of the two dramatic texts under consideration.
